Paul Fontaine is joined by F4WOnline.com's Bryan Rose to break down a lackluster AEW Dynamite from Cincinnati โ but the show delivered some major Forbidden Door developments. The duo start by discussing the changes made to the women's Owen Hart Cup tournament before diving into the night's action. Jon Moxley retained the Continental Championship against Shane Taylor, with the win setting up a 5-on-5 street fight for Collision. Mark Briscoe met with Tony Khan to get the Forbidden Door main event: a 6-on-6 cage match with Briscoe and MJF picking their respective teams. Maya World subbed in for Saree and knocked off Skye Blue to advance to the women's Owen Cup semifinals. Swerve Strickland beat Brody King in the main event to punch his ticket to the men's Owen Cup final.
